Our home tour is a self-guided tour of five to seven historic homes ranging in architectural styles from Victorian to Craftsman and Spanish Revival. Each home reflects a sense of charm and is open to the public for one day during the Garfield Heights Neighborhood Association Home Tour. Garfield Heights is the second oldest historic neighborhood in the City of Pasadena, architects for the neighborhood include Green, Sylvanus Marston and Arthur Benton.
